Output ae76889852bce68bed7ead9f4901580f9533bc757a7044419b7dc6cc6f79ae23:6

value
5100000
script pubkey
OP_0 OP_PUSHBYTES_20 7a6087c7c0f4c08122de3d123997a546f946dbc2
address
bc1q0fsg037q7nqgzgk785frn9a9gmu5dk7zay4d84
transaction
ae76889852bce68bed7ead9f4901580f9533bc757a7044419b7dc6cc6f79ae23
confirmations
312766
spent
true